这个我无法弄清楚我正在运行 osx sierra 但有一段时间很好,然后当我尝试进行捆绑更新时突然
我尝试了所有我有谷歌的东西并完全重新安装了自制软件和 postgres 但没有任何帮助,非常感谢
我认为可能有问题的是设置 postgres 的位置
Using config values from /usr/pgsql-9.5.4/bin/pg_config
sh: /usr/pgsql-9.5.4/bin/pg_config: No such file or directory
sh: /usr/pgsql-9.5.4/bin/pg_config: No such file or directory
我在这里改变了一些东西,但不知道我做了什么,也不知道如何取回它
Gem::Ext::BuildError: ERROR: Failed to build gem native extension.
current directory:
/Users/raycove/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/pg-0.19.0/ext
/Users/raycove/.rbenv/versions/2.3.1/bin/ruby -r
./siteconf20160930-43553-1i5ubpk.rb extconf.rb
--with-pg-config=/usr/pgsql-9.5.4/bin/pg_config
Using config values from /usr/pgsql-9.5.4/bin/pg_config
sh: /usr/pgsql-9.5.4/bin/pg_config: No such file or directory
sh: /usr/pgsql-9.5.4/bin/pg_config: No such file or directory
checking for libpq-fe.h... yes
checking for libpq/libpq-fs.h... yes
checking for pg_config_manual.h... yes
checking for PQconnectdb() in -lpq... yes
checking for PQconnectionUsedPassword()... yes
checking for PQisthreadsafe()... yes
checking for PQprepare()... yes
checking for PQexecParams()... yes
checking for PQescapeString()... yes
checking for PQescapeStringConn()... yes
checking for PQescapeLiteral()... yes
checking for PQescapeIdentifier()... yes
checking for PQgetCancel()... yes
checking for lo_create()... yes
checking for pg_encoding_to_char()... yes
checking for pg_char_to_encoding()... yes
checking for PQsetClientEncoding()... yes
checking for PQlibVersion()... yes
checking for PQping()... yes
checking for PQsetSingleRowMode()... yes
checking for PQconninfo()... yes
checking for PQsslAttribute()... yes
checking for rb_encdb_alias()... yes
checking for rb_enc_alias()... yes
checking for rb_thread_call_without_gvl()... yes
checking for rb_thread_call_with_gvl()... yes
checking for rb_thread_fd_select()... yes
checking for rb_w32_wrap_io_handle()... no
checking for rb_str_modify_expand()... yes
checking for rb_hash_dup()... yes
checking for PGRES_COPY_BOTH in libpq-fe.h... yes
checking for PGRES_SINGLE_TUPLE in libpq-fe.h... yes
checking for PG_DIAG_TABLE_NAME in libpq-fe.h... yes
checking for struct pgNotify.extra in libpq-fe.h... yes
checking for unistd.h... yes
checking for inttypes.h... yes
checking for ruby/st.h... yes
checking for C99 variable length arrays... yes
creating extconf.h
creating Makefile
To see why this extension failed to compile, please check the mkmf.log which can
be found here:
/Users/raycove/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/extensions/x86_64-darwin-16/2.3.0-static/pg-0.19.0/mkmf.log
current directory:
/Users/raycove/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/pg-0.19.0/ext
make "DESTDIR=" clean
current directory:
/Users/raycove/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/pg-0.19.0/ext
make "DESTDIR="
compiling gvl_wrappers.c
compiling pg.c
compiling pg_binary_decoder.c
compiling pg_binary_encoder.c
compiling pg_coder.c
compiling pg_connection.c
compiling pg_copy_coder.c
compiling pg_errors.c
compiling pg_result.c
compiling pg_text_decoder.c
compiling pg_text_encoder.c
compiling pg_type_map.c
compiling pg_type_map_all_strings.c
compiling pg_type_map_by_class.c
compiling pg_type_map_by_column.c
compiling pg_type_map_by_mri_type.c
compiling pg_type_map_by_oid.c
compiling pg_type_map_in_ruby.c
compiling util.c
linking shared-object pg_ext.bundle
ld: file not found: dynamic_lookup
clang: error: linker command failed with exit code 1 (use -v to see invocation)
make: *** [pg_ext.bundle] Error 1
make failed, exit code 2
Gem files will remain installed in
/Users/raycove/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/gems/pg-0.19.0 for
inspection.
Results logged to
/Users/raycove/.rbenv/versions/2.3.1/lib/ruby/gems/2.3.0/extensions/x86_64-darwin-16/2.3.0-static/pg-0.19.0/gem_make.out
An error occurred while installing pg (0.19.0), and Bundler cannot
continue.
Make sure that `gem install pg -v '0.19.0'` succeeds before bundling.